Essential Job Duties:

  • Commitment to the mission, vision and values of Third Street Family Health Services.
  • Takes personal responsibility to promote health equity.
  • Provides care without judgment.
  • Answer phones in a professional and courteous manner and respond to patient/customer requests as appropriate.
  • Competently utilizes the electronic health record.
  • Competently schedules patients for transportation services.
  • Ensure accuracy of patient demographic and insurance information to promote proper and expedient billing.
  • Correctly routes patient and client communication through appropriate channels as per organizational policy.
  • Promote, educate and leverage technology to ensure patient satisfaction, collaboration, and continuity of care.
  • Requires high level of discretion as related to privacy and confidentiality.
  • Endeavor to provide adequate notice of time away from work.
  • Makes reminder calls and follows up with patients as needed directed.
  • Scans and indexes documents appropriately into the EHR daily.
  • Provides excellent customer service to patients, clients and colleagues.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• High School Diploma or equivalent preferred.
  • Experience in customer service, preferred.
  • Experience in health care and registration, preferred.
